﻿body{

font-size:12px;

}

H1{	font-style:normal;font-size:12px;font-weight:normal;text-decoration:none;display:inline;}
H2{	font-style:normal;font-size:12px;font-weight:normal;text-decoration:none;display:inline;}
H3{	font-style:normal;font-size:12px;font-weight:normal;text-decoration:none;display:inline;}
H4{	font-style:normal;font-size:12px;font-weight:normal;text-decoration:none;display:inline;}
H5{	font-style:normal;font-size:12px;font-weight:normal;text-decoration:none;display:inline;}

a.textoLink{
	font-family:arial;
	color:#666666;
	font-size:18px;
	text-decoration:none;
}
a:visited.textoLink {
	color:#000000;
}
a:hover.textoLink {
	color:#000000;
}
a{
text-decoration:none;

}

/*body { margin: 0; font-family: Verdana; }*/

div.exterior { width: 770px; }

/* MENU IZQ AYUDA*/
a.menuayuda{
	font-family:arial;
	color:#666666;
	font-size:12px;
	text-decoration:none;

}
a:visited.menuayuda {
	color:#000000;
}
a:hover.menuayuda {
	color:#000000;
}

/* MENU NIVEL 2*/
.menu2 {
	text-decoration:none;
	font-family:arial;
	font-size:10px;
	color:#666666;
}

/* FORMATO */
/* float */
.fl { float: left; }
.fr { float: right; }
.clear { clear: both; }
/* font style */
.b { font-weight: bold; }
.l { font-weight: lighter; }
.u { text-decoration: underline; }
.n { text-decoration: none; }
.i { font-style: italic; }
.ttu { text-transform: uppercase; }
/* text aling*/
.tac { text-align: center; }
.tal { text-align: left; }
.tar { text-align: right; }
.taj { text-align: justify; }
/* font family*/
.ffv { font-family: Verdana; }
.ffa { font-family: Arial; }
.ffg { font-family: Georgia; }
.fft { font-family: Trebuchet MS; }
/*font size*/
.s9 { font-size: 9px; }
.s10 { font-size: 10px; }
.s11 { font-size: 11px; }
.s12 { font-size: 12px; }
.s13 { font-size: 13px; }
.s14 { font-size: 14px; }
.s16 { font-size: 16px; }
.s18 { font-size: 18px; }
.s20 { font-size: 20px; }
.s24 { font-size: 24px; }
.s28 { font-size: 28px; }
.s30 { font-size: 30px; }
.s60 { font-size: 60px; }
/* FIN FORMATO */

/* COLORES */
.cFFFFFF        { color: #FFFFFF; } /* Blanco */
.cFFF9EE        { color: #FFF9EE; } /* Blanco Crema */
.cFEFEFE        { color: #FEFEFE; } /* Blanco 2 */
.c000000        { color: #000000; } /* Negro */
.c774500        { color: #774500; } /* Maron 1 */
.c966D37        { color: #966D37; } /* Maron 2 */
.c390200        { color: #390200; } /* Maron 3 */
.c5E4212        { color: #5E4212; } /* Maron 4 */
.c7A643E        { color: #7A643E; } /* Maron 5 */
.c847F6E        { color: #847F6E; } /* Maron 6 */
.c5C5341        { color: #5C5341; } /* Maron 7 */
.c763E0D        { color: #763E0D; } /* Maron 8 */
.c857148        { color: #857148; } /* Maron 9 */
.c99733F        { color: #99733F; } /* Maron 10 */
.c544736        { color: #544736; } /* Gris 1 */
.c696969        { color: #696969; } /* Gris 2 */
.c797977        { color: #797977; } /* Gris 3 */
.c7A7879        { color: #7A7879; } /* Gris 4 */
.c333333        { color: #333333; } /* Gris 5 */
.c605D57        { color: #605D57; } /* Gris 6 */
.c7A7A7A        { color: #7A7A7A; } /* Gris 7 */
.c595151        { color: #595151; } /* Gris 8 */
.c5C5341        { color: #5C5341; }
.c6A5B48        { color: #6A5B48; }
.c615443        { color: #615443; }
.c5B503A        { color: #5B503A; }
.c71604C        { color: #71604C; }
.c7C7561        { color: #7C7561; }
.c7C756C        { color: #7C756C; }
.c0F2672        { color: #0F2672; } /* Azul 1 */
.c7F7864        { color: #7F7864; }
.c666666        { color: #666666; }/*letras gris oscuras*/
.cBCBCBC        { color: #BCBCBC; }/*letras gris claras*/
.ccelebridades  { color: #A80000; }
.cbelleza       { color: #A80071; }
.cfashion       { color: #7001A8; }
.cestilo        { color: #0000A8; }
.csalud         { color: #0170A8; }
.cespiritu      { color: #00A970; }
.cpareja        { color: #70A800; }
.cemprendedoras { color: #E1BE00; }
.cfamilia       { color: #E17F00; }
.cFF7F00        { color: #FF7F00; } /* naranja categorias */
/* FIN COLORES*/

/* LINKS */

.aGrisNegro       { color: #666666; text-decoration: none; }
.aGrisNegro:hover { color: #000000; }

/* FIN LINKS */

/* COLORES FONDOS */
.cfBDA078 { background-color: #BDA078; } /* Maron 1 */
.cfC7B494 { background-color: #C7B494; } /* Maron 2 */
.cfD7C9AF { background-color: #D7C9AF; } /* Maron 3 */
.cfB09A74 { background-color: #B09A74; } /* Maron 4 */
.cfD8D4C8 { background-color: #D8D4C8; } /* Gris 1 */
.cfCEC9B6 { background-color: #CEC9B6; } /* Gris 2 */
.cfECECEC { background-color: #ECECEC; } /* gris 3 */
.cfEDE6D5 { background-color: #EDE6D5; } /* Crema 1 */
.cfDFD3B9 { background-color: #DFD3B9; } /* Crema 2 */
/* FIN COLORES FONDOS */

/* BORDES */
/* Manejo de bordes:
 * para bordear todo el contorno de un objeto basta con agregar "b1" mas un "bc[Color]" y un stilo "bs[Style]"
 * para contornear lados individualmente la primera clase del grupo de clases q manejan los bordes debe ser "b0"
 */
.b0 { border: 0px; }
.b1 { border: 1px; }
.bt1 { border-top-width: 1px; }
.br1 { border-right-width: 1px; }
.bb1 { border-bottom-width: 1px; }
.bl1 { border-left-width: 1px; }
.b2 { border: 2px; }
.bt2 { border-top-width: 2px; }
.br2 { border-right-width: 2px; }
.bb2 { border-bottom-width: 2px; }
.bl2 { border-left-width: 2px; }
/* border style */
.bsSolid { border-style: solid; }
.bsDotted { border-style: dotted; }
/* border color */
.bc000000 { border-color: #000000; }
.bcFFFFFF { border-color: #FFFFFF; }
.bc7B7069 { border-color: #7B7069; }
.bcBAAE96 { border-color: #BAAE96; }
.bc7A7A7A { border-color: #7A7A7A; }
/* FIN BORDES */


/* MENU IMPRIMIR */
a.menuimprimir{
	font-family:Georgia, serif;
	color:#BBBBBB;
	font-size:14px;
	text-decoration:none;

}

a:hover.menuimprimir {
	color:#FF7F00;
}
/* FIN MENU IMPRIMIR */

a.sponsors:hover img {
	filter: alpha(opacity=40);
	opacity: .4 ;
}

.navegacion_top {
	background: #C7B494 url(../_modulos/navegacion/_imgs/vistalba/navegacion_bg.png) no-repeat;
	height: 100%;
	padding-top: 10px;
	padding-bottom: 10px;
}

.input_buscador {
	background-color: #d8d4c8;
	border-right: #d9d5c9 2px solid;
	border-bottom: #d9d5c9 2px solid;
	border-left: #c8c4b9 2px solid;
	border-top: #b4b0a5 2px solid;
	font-family: Verdana;
	font-size: 12px;
	font-weight: normal;
	width: 246px;
	height: 27px;
	color: #000000;
	padding-top: 7px;
}

.boton_buscador {
	background: #cec9b6 url(../_modulos/notas/_imgs/vistalba/boton_buscador_bg.png) no-repeat;
	border: 0px solid #d8d4c8;
	width: 32px;
	height: 22px;
}

.login {
	height:100%;
}

.log_input {
	border: 0px solid #ffffff;
	font-family: Verdana;
	font-size: 10px;
	font-weight: normal;
	color: #000000;
	width: 188px;
	height: 16px;
	padding-top: 2px;
}

.boton_close_login {
	background: url(../_modulos/usuariosweb/_imgs/vistalba/login_close.png) no-repeat;
	border: 0px solid #5c4d3b;
	width: 18px;
	height: 18px;
}

.boton_ok_login {
	background: url(../_modulos/usuariosweb/_imgs/vistalba/login_ok.png) no-repeat;
	border: 0px solid #aa9570;
	width: 33px;
	height: 25px;
}

.video {
	width: 256px;
}

.destacada {
	background: #D6C9A6 url(../_modulos/notas/_imgs/vistalba/destacada_bg.png) repeat-x;
	height: 100%;
}

.destacada2 {
	background: #DFD3B9 url(../_modulos/notas/_imgs/vistalba/destacada2_bg.png) repeat-x;
	height: 100%;
}

.listado_evaluaciones {
	width: 385px;
}

.footer {
	background: url(../_modulos/footer/_imgs/vistalba/footer_sep.png) repeat-x;
	padding: 12px 0 0 0;
	font-family: Verdana;
	font-size: 9px;
	font-weight: normal;
	color: #696969;
	text-align: center;
}

.reg_tit {
	background: #B09A74 url(../_modulos/usuariosweb/_imgs/vistalba/reg_tit_bg.png) repeat-y top right;
	width: 100%;
	height: 35px;
	font-family: Arial;
	font-size: 11px;
	font-weight: normal;
	text-transform: uppercase;
	color: #fff9ee;
	padding-right: 20px;
}

.reg_input {
	border: 0px solid #ffffff;
	font-family: Arial;
	font-size: 11px;
	font-weight: normal;
	color: #7A643E;
	width: 188px;
	height: 16px;
	padding-top: 2px;
}

.reg_select {
	border: 0px solid #ffffff;
	font-family: Arial;
	font-size: 11px;
	font-weight: normal;
	color: #7a643e;
}

.input_textarea {
	background-color: #d8d4c8;
	border-right: #d9d5c9 2px solid;
	border-bottom: #d9d5c9 2px solid;
	border-left: #c8c4b9 2px solid;
	border-top: #b4b0a5 2px solid;
	font-family: Verdana;
	font-size: 12px;
	font-weight: normal;
	width: 246px;
	height: 145px;
	color: #000000;
	padding-top: 7px;
}

.sep_gris {
	height: 4;
	background-color: #ECECEC;
	width:100%;

}
.Top5_sep{
	padding:6px 0px 6px 0px;

}

.banner_interno{
width:290px;
height:84px;
padding-left:12px;
}
.txt_buscar {
border:none;
}
.div_txt_buscar_linea{
width:160px;
text-align:right;
border-top-color:#EBEBEB;
border-top-width:1px;
border-top-style:solid;

}

.dotted01 {
	background: url(../_modulos/notas/_imgs/altonivel/dotted_line.gif);
}

.dottedLine {
	background: url(../_modulos/notas/_imgs/altonivel/dotted_line.gif) center repeat-x;
}

.blockPage { -moz-opacity: .5; filter: alpha(opacity=50); opacity:.5; }

.style_ {
}

/* ESTILOS MENU NIVEL 2*/
.style_celebridades
{
	border-bottom:5px solid #A80000;
}

.style_belleza
{
	border-bottom:5px solid #A80070;
}

.style_fashion
{
	border-bottom:5px solid #7000A8;
}

.style_estilo
{
	border-bottom:5px solid #0000A8;
}

.style_salud
{
	border-bottom:5px solid #0070A8;
}

.style_espiritu
{
	border-bottom:5px solid #00A870;
}

.style_pareja
{
	border-bottom:5px solid #70A800;
}

.style_emprendedoras
{
	border-bottom:5px solid #E1BF00;
}

.style_familia
{
	border-bottom:5px solid #E17F00;
}

.style_registro
{
	border-bottom:5px solid #BBBBBB;
}

.style_ingresar
{
	border-bottom:5px solid #BBBBBB;
}

/* FIN ESTILOS MENU NIVEL 2*/

/* ESTILOS MENU EXTENDIDO */

a.menuItems
{
	font-family: Arial;
	font-size: 12px;
	color: #666666;
	text-decoration:none;
}

a.menuItems:hover
{
	color: #000000;
}

.menu_padre
{
	font-family: Arial;
	font-size: 12px;
	text-decoration:none;
	color: #666666;
}

.menu_padre:hover
{
	color: #000000;
}

.menu_padre_selected
{
	font-family: Arial;
	font-size: 12px;
	text-decoration:none;
	color: #000000;
}

div.menu_login
{
	font-family: Arial;
	font-size: 12px;
	text-decoration:none;
	color: #BBBBBB;
}

div.menu_login_selected
{
	font-family: Arial;
	font-size: 12px;
	text-decoration:none;
	color: #000000;
}

a.menu_login
{
	font-family: Arial;
	font-size: 12px;
	text-decoration:none;
	color: #BBBBBB;
}

a.menu_login:hover
{
	color: #000000;
}

a.menu_login_selected
{
	font-family: Arial;
	font-size: 12px;
	text-decoration:none;
	color: #000000;
}

div.menu_toggler {
	border: 1px solid #DBE3E7;
	background-color: #FFFFFF;
	width: 324px;
	margin: 0;
	padding: .5em;
	position: absolute;
	left: 0;
	clear: both;
	opacity: 0.8;
	filter: alpha(opacity=80)
}
div.menu_toggler table, div.menu_toggler td {
	border: 0;
	margin: 0;
}
div.menu_toggler table {
	border-collapse: collapse;
	width: 100%;
}
div.menu_toggler td {
	padding: 2px;
}
div.menu_toggler a {
	font-family: Arial, Tahoma, sans-serif;
	font-size: 11px;
	text-decoration: none;
	color: #000;
}
/* FIN ESTILOS MENU EXTENDIDO */

/* ESTILO MENU VERTICAL */
.menuV_
{
	font-family: Arial, Trebuchet, sans-serif;
	font-size: 12px;
	text-decoration: none;
	color: #676767;
}

.menuV_:hover
{
	color: #000000;
}

.menuV_vertical_selected
{
	font-family: Arial, Trebuchet, sans-serif;
	font-size: 12px;
	text-decoration: none;
	color: #000000;
}

a.menu_nivel_1
{
	color: #666666;
	font-size:11;
	text-decoration: none;
	text-transform:uppercase;
	font-family: Arial, Trebuchet, sans-serif;
	font-weight:bold;
}
/* FIN ESTILO MENU VERTICAL */

.encuesta
{
	color:#666666;
	font-weight: bold;
}

.encuesta_win
{
	color:#FF7F00;
	font-weight: bold;
}

.caracter
{
	color:#666666;
	font-weight: bold;
	font-size:15px;
}

.caracter_win
{
	color:#FF7F00;
	font-weight: bold;
	font-size:15px;
}

.btnImg{background-color:transparent;border:0 none;margin:0;padding:0;cursor:pointer}
.btnImg img{border:0;margin:0}